Lifetime Costs of Prophylactic Mastectomies and Reconstruction versus Surveillance

Abstract

These findings are consistent with contralateral and bilateral prophylactic mastectomy being cost saving in many scenarios, regardless of the reconstructive option chosen. They suggest that physicians and patients should continue to receive flexibility in deciding how best to proceed clinically in each case.
